Negligence

Like a car accident to be able to claim compensation in a boating crash case, you must prove that negligence by another party directly caused your injury. In a boating accident, determining fault is more difficult than in the case of a car crash. There are specific laws and rules to be adhered to in determining the liability. An experienced attorney will analyze the evidence in order to determine who was negligent.

Boat accidents are often caused by human error, mechanical issues and other factors which could have been avoided with proper maintenance or prudence. These incidents could be triggered by careless or reckless actions like driving too fast, drunk, inattention, or drowsiness.

For instance, imagine that you are a passenger on a sailing vessel moored at the dock when suddenly small motorboats come in at a high speed and slams into the side of your vessel. In the event, you suffer significant injuries to your head, back and neck.

The person who operates the boat is responsible for damages just like the driver of a car would be. It is possible that the owner of the boat could be liable as well when they permit a person to operate the boat who cannot safely do so. This is often the case for tour boats or commercial vessels.

Most boat owners are insured against loss or damage. A typical boating policy will include hull and personal property coverage to cover repairs and replacement of your vessel in the event that it is damaged or stolen in the event of an accident. Many boat owners carry medical payment insurance that covers first aid treatment as well as other costs, incurred by passengers injured on the vessel. Many boaters also have umbrella policies that provide additional liability protection over and above their normal boating insurance.
